Electric cables
Electric cables
To prepare international standards for the design, testing and end-use recommendations (including current ratings) for insulated electrical power and control cables, their accessories and cable systems, for use in wiring and in power generation, distribution and transmission. The applications cover an unlimited range of voltage and current, and includes applications such as cables for photovoltaic installations, charging cables for electric vehicles, HVDC cables (land and sub-sea), High Temperature Superconducting (HTS) cables and heating cables where the current is used to create heat. Cables specifically designed for marine applications covered by SC 18A are excluded. All cables for communication, data transmission and other non-power applications are covered elsewhere. TC 20 holds a Group Safety Function for fire hazard testing on cables comprising:<br /> - flame propagation tests;<br /> - fire resistance tests;<br /> - smoke optical density tests;<br /> - corrosivity tests.

Overhead electrical conductors
Overhead electrical conductors
To prepare International Standards and Specifications for fabrication and utilization of overhead electrical conductors, including:<br /> <br /> - All types of overhead ground wires,<br /> - All shapes of round and non-round wires,<br /> - Conductors made of various metals such as aluminium, steel, copper, or composite material supporting core etc. and their combinations,<br /> - Test methods for assessment of overhead electrical conductor performance in operation,<br /> - Have the cooperation with TC11 on hardware and accessories directly connected to conductor for the purpose of maintaining electrical/mechanical continuity, -<br /> <br /> Have the cooperation with SC86A on aerial optical cables used either for phase conductors or ground wires, such as the publication of the original OPGW standard now named IEC 60794-4.
